<?xml version="1.0" encoding="UTF-8" ?>

<bugzilla version="5.2"
          urlbase="https://bugzilla.altlinux.org/"
          
          maintainer="jenya@basealt.ru"
>

    <bug>
          <bug_id>33401</bug_id>
          
          <creation_ts>2017-04-20 17:38:14 +0300</creation_ts>
          <short_desc>[guile22] падает alteratord</short_desc>
          <delta_ts>2017-05-16 14:42:32 +0300</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>4</classification_id>
          <classification>Development</classification>
          <product>Sisyphus</product>
          <component>alterator-vm</component>
          <version>unstable</version>
          <rep_platform>all</rep_platform>
          <op_sys>Linux</op_sys>
          <bug_status>CLOSED</bug_status>
          <resolution>FIXED</resolution>
          
          
          <bug_file_loc>https://bugzilla.altlinux.org/show_bug.cgi?id=33391#c5</b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ords>regression</keywords>
          <priority>P3</priority>
          <bug_severity>norm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Michael Shigorin">mike</reporter>
          <assigned_to name="Олег Соловьев">mcpain</assigned_to>
          <cc>imz</cc>
    
    <cc>mcpain</cc>
          
          <qa_contact>qa-sisyphus</qa_contact>

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>163377</commentid>
    <comment_count>0</comment_count>
    <who name="Michael Shigorin">mike</who>
    <bug_when>2017-04-20 17:38:14 +0300</bug_when>
    <thetext>(вынесено отдельно из обсуждения bug 33391, comment 5 и далее)

livecd-install падает при попытке запуска из livecd (например, regular-lxde.iso) перед самым запуском или сразу после загрузки blonde.scm:

[altlinux@localhost ~]$ livecd-install
WARNING: (alterator lookout evaluation): imported module (alterator presentation events) overrides core binding `when&apos;
frame:on-next is deprecated, use wizard-bind instead
frame:next-activity is deprecated, use wizard-update-activity instead
frame:next-activity is deprecated, use wizard-update-activity instead
frame:on-next is deprecated, use wizard-bind instead
frame:on-back is deprecated, use wizard-bind instead
frame:on-next is deprecated, use wizard-bind instead
Backtrace:
In interfaces/guile/lookout/goto.scm:
     31:2 19 (clean-widget #&lt;procedure 996ae0 at interfaces/guile/o…&gt; …)
In interfaces/guile/presentation/container.scm:
   212:44 18 (_ _ _)
In ice-9/eval.scm:
   293:34 17 (_ #(#(#&lt;directory (alterator lookout evaluation)…&gt; …) …))
    619:8 16 (_ #(#(#&lt;directory (alterator lookout evaluation) 9…&gt; …)))
In interfaces/guile/lookout/goto.scm:
    38:25 15 (clean-widget #&lt;procedure 7c2660 at interfaces/guile/o…&gt; …)
In ice-9/eval.scm:
   174:20 14 (_ #(#(#&lt;directory (alterator lookout evaluation) 9…&gt; …)))
   177:49 13 (lp (#&lt;procedure da1f00 at ice-9/eval.scm:182:7 (env)&gt; …))
   177:49 12 (lp (#&lt;procedure da1ee0 at ice-9/eval.scm:182:7 (env)&gt; …))
   177:32 11 (lp (#&lt;procedure da1ea0 at ice-9/eval.scm:187:12 (env)&gt;))
In srfi/srfi-1.scm:
   679:15 10 (append-map _ _ . _)
   592:17  9 (map1 (&quot;sda1&quot; &quot;sda2&quot; &quot;sda5&quot;))
In unknown file:
           8 (_ #&lt;procedure e818c0 at ice-9/eval.scm:330:13 ()&gt; #&lt;p…&gt; …)
In ice-9/eval.scm:
    159:9  7 (_ #(#(#&lt;directory (alterator lookout evaluation) 9…&gt; …)))
    155:9  6 (_ _)
In interfaces/guile/logfile.scm:
     37:7  5 (_ 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ru_RU&quot;) …)) …)
In interfaces/guile/d.scm:
   162:10  4 (_ 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ru_RU&quot;) …)) …)
In srfi/srfi-1.scm:
   679:15  3 (append-map _ _ . _)
   592:17  2 (map1 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ru…&quot;) …)))
In unknown file:
           1 (request-unix-server &quot;/var/run/alteratord/.socket&quot; &quot;(\…&quot; …)
In ice-9/boot-9.scm:
   756:25  0 (dispatch-exception 0 internal-error (wrong-type-arg # …))

ice-9/boot-9.scm:756:25: In procedure dispatch-exception:
ice-9/boot-9.scm:756:25: Throw to key `internal-error&apos; with args `(wrong-type-arg &quot;cdr&quot; &quot;Wrong type argument in position ~A (expecting ~A): ~S&quot; (1 &quot;pair&quot; obj) (obj))&apos;.
[altlinux@localhost ~]$ _

При этом инсталер (например, regular-server.iso на том же mkimage-profiles
с теми же версиями пакетов) с /vm/orthodox _не_ падает, хотя и отказывается устанавливаться на 16 Гб при выбранном &quot;очистить все диски&quot; и заведомо умещающемся в такое место профиле разбивки под предлогом недостатка места.

Версии причастных пакетов:
guile-evms-0.5-alt2
alterator-vm-0.4.4-alt1
alterator-5.0-alt2</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>163389</commentid>
    <comment_count>1</comment_count>
    <who name="Repository Robot">repository-robot</who>
    <bug_when>2017-04-20 19:59:43 +0300</bug_when>
    <thetext>guile-evms-0.5-alt3 -&gt; sisyphus:

* Thu Apr 20 2017 Sergey Bolshakov &lt;sbolshakov@altlinux&gt; 0.5-alt3
- sporadic fix for random crashes, hopefully (closes: #33401)</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>163404</commentid>
    <comment_count>2</comment_count>
    <who name="Michael Shigorin">mike</who>
    <bug_when>2017-04-21 12:29:22 +0300</bug_when>
    <thetext>Увы:

[altlinux@localhost ~]$ livecd-install
;;; note: auto-compilation is enabled, set GUILE_AUTO_COMPILE=0
;;;       or pass the --no-auto-compile argument to disable.
;;; compiling /usr/sbin/alterator-wizard
;;; compiled /root/.cache/guile/ccache/2.2-LE-8-3.9/usr/sbin/alterator-wizard.go
WARNING: (alterator lookout evaluation): imported module (alterator presentation events) overrides core binding `when&apos;
frame:on-next is deprecated, use wizard-bind instead
frame:next-activity is deprecated, use wizard-update-activity instead
frame:next-activity is deprecated, use wizard-update-activity instead
frame:on-next is deprecated, use wizard-bind instead
frame:on-back is deprecated, use wizard-bind instead
frame:on-next is deprecated, use wizard-bind instead
Backtrace:
In interfaces/guile/lookout/goto.scm:
     31:2 19 (clean-widget #&lt;procedure aba3a0 at interfaces/guile/o…&gt; …)
In interfaces/guile/presentation/container.scm:
   212:44 18 (_ _ _)
In ice-9/eval.scm:
   293:34 17 (_ #(#(#&lt;directory (alterator lookout evaluation)…&gt; …) …))
    619:8 16 (_ #(#(#&lt;directory (alterator lookout evaluation) 7…&gt; …)))
In interfaces/guile/lookout/goto.scm:
    38:25 15 (clean-widget #&lt;procedure 107b480 at interfaces/guile/…&gt; …)
In ice-9/eval.scm:
   174:20 14 (_ #(#(#&lt;directory (alterator lookout evaluation) 7…&gt; …)))
   177:49 13 (lp (#&lt;procedure dbc340 at ice-9/eval.scm:182:7 (env)&gt; …))
   177:49 12 (lp (#&lt;procedure dbc320 at ice-9/eval.scm:182:7 (env)&gt; …))
   177:32 11 (lp (#&lt;procedure dbc2a0 at ice-9/eval.scm:187:12 (env)&gt;))
In srfi/srfi-1.scm:
   679:15 10 (append-map _ _ . _)
   592:17  9 (map1 (&quot;sda1&quot;))
In unknown file:
           8 (_ #&lt;procedure e303c0 at ice-9/eval.scm:330:13 ()&gt; #&lt;p…&gt; …)
In ice-9/eval.scm:
    159:9  7 (_ #(#(#&lt;directory (alterator lookout evaluation) 7…&gt; …)))
    155:9  6 (_ _)
In interfaces/guile/logfile.scm:
     37:7  5 (_ 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ru_RU&quot;) …)) …)
In interfaces/guile/d.scm:
   162:10  4 (_ 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ru_RU&quot;) …)) …)
In srfi/srfi-1.scm:
   679:15  3 (append-map _ _ . _)
   592:17  2 (map1 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ru…&quot;) …)))
In unknown file:
           1 (request-unix-server &quot;/var/run/alteratord/.socket&quot; &quot;(\…&quot; …)
In ice-9/boot-9.scm:
   756:25  0 (dispatch-exception 0 internal-error (wrong-type-arg # …))

ice-9/boot-9.scm:756:25: In procedure dispatch-exception:
ice-9/boot-9.scm:756:25: Throw to key `internal-error&apos; with args `(wrong-type-arg &quot;cdr&quot; &quot;Wrong type argument in position ~A (expecting ~A): ~S&quot; (1 &quot;pair&quot; obj) (obj))&apos;.
[altlinux@localhost ~]$ _

PS: разница в поведении блонды и ортодокса наводит на мысль, что эта грабелька может быть уже в alterator-vm, нет?</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>163434</commentid>
    <comment_count>3</comment_count>
    <who name="Sergey Bolshakov">sbolshakov</who>
    <bug_when>2017-04-24 15:43:24 +0300</bug_when>
    <thetext>alterator-vm-0.4.5-alt1</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>163456</commentid>
    <comment_count>4</comment_count>
    <who name="Michael Shigorin">mike</who>
    <bug_when>2017-04-25 20:02:15 +0300</bug_when>
    <thetext>(В ответ на комментарий №3)
&gt; alterator-vm-0.4.5-alt1
К сожалению, сегодняшние регулярки с ним тоже падают:

[altlinux@localhost ~]$ livecd-install
;;; note: auto-compilation is enabled, set GUILE_AUTO_COMPILE=0
;;;       or pass the --no-auto-compile argument to disable.
;;; compiling /usr/sbin/alterator-wizard
;;; compiled /root/.cache/guile/ccache/2.2-LE-4-3.9/usr/sbin/alterator-wizard.go
WARNING: (alterator lookout evaluation): imported module (alterator presentation events) overrides core binding `when&apos;
frame:on-next is deprecated, use wizard-bind instead
frame:next-activity is deprecated, use wizard-update-activity instead
frame:next-activity is deprecated, use wizard-update-activity instead
frame:on-next is deprecated, use wizard-bind instead
frame:on-back is deprecated, use wizard-bind instead
frame:on-next is deprecated, use wizard-bind instead
Backtrace:
In interfaces/guile/lookout/goto.scm:
     31:2 19 (clean-widget #&lt;procedure 81dddd0 at interfaces/guile/…&gt; …)
In interfaces/guile/presentation/container.scm:
   212:44 18 (_ _ _)
In ice-9/eval.scm:
   293:34 17 (_ #(#(#&lt;directory (alterator lookout evaluation)…&gt; …) …))
    619:8 16 (_ #(#(#&lt;directory (alterator lookout evaluation) 8…&gt; …)))
In interfaces/guile/lookout/goto.scm:
    38:25 15 (clean-widget #&lt;procedure 8680810 at interfaces/guile/…&gt; …)
In ice-9/eval.scm:
   174:20 14 (_ #(#(#&lt;directory (alterator lookout evaluation) 8…&gt; …)))
   177:49 13 (lp (#&lt;procedure 87a5970 at ice-9/eval.scm:182:7 (en…&gt; …))
   177:49 12 (lp (#&lt;procedure 87a5960 at ice-9/eval.scm:182:7 (en…&gt; …))
   177:32 11 (lp (#&lt;procedure 87a5940 at ice-9/eval.scm:187:12 (env)&gt;))
In srfi/srfi-1.scm:
   679:15 10 (append-map _ _ . _)
   592:17  9 (map1 (&quot;sda1&quot; &quot;sda2&quot; &quot;sda5&quot;))
In unknown file:
           8 (_ #&lt;procedure 816ae30 at ice-9/eval.scm:330:13 ()&gt; #&lt;…&gt; …)
In ice-9/eval.scm:
    159:9  7 (_ #(#(#&lt;directory (alterator lookout evaluation) 8…&gt; …)))
    155:9  6 (_ _)
In interfaces/guile/logfile.scm:
     37:7  5 (_ 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ru_RU&quot;) …)) …)
In interfaces/guile/d.scm:
   162:10  4 (_ 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ru_RU&quot;) …)) …)
In srfi/srfi-1.scm:
   679:15  3 (append-map _ _ . _)
   592:17  2 (map1 ((&quot;/evms/storage/volumes/sda1&quot; language (&quot;ru…&quot;) …)))
In unknown file:
           1 (request-unix-server &quot;/var/run/alteratord/.socket&quot; &quot;(\…&quot; …)
In ice-9/boot-9.scm:
   756:25  0 (dispatch-exception 0 internal-error (wrong-type-arg # …))

ice-9/boot-9.scm:756:25: In procedure dispatch-exception:
ice-9/boot-9.scm:756:25: Throw to key `internal-error&apos; with args `(wrong-type-arg &quot;cdr&quot; &quot;Wrong type argument in position ~A (expecting ~A): ~S&quot; (1 &quot;pair&quot; obj) (obj))&apos;.
[altlinux@localhost ~]$ _</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>163470</commentid>
    <comment_count>5</comment_count>
    <who name="Sergey Bolshakov">sbolshakov</who>
    <bug_when>2017-04-26 18:56:01 +0300</bug_when>
    <thetext>мне отчего-то кажется, что дело в том, что кто-то не установил нужный mkfs.*</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>163478</commentid>
    <comment_count>6</comment_count>
    <who name="Repository Robot">repository-robot</who>
    <bug_when>2017-04-27 22:53:41 +0300</bug_when>
    <thetext>guile-evms-0.5-alt5 -&gt; sisyphus:

* Thu Apr 27 2017 Sergey Bolshakov &lt;sbolshakov@altlinux&gt; 0.5-alt5
- fixed crash in alterator-vm (closes: #33401)</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>163700</commentid>
    <comment_count>7</comment_count>
    <who name="Michael Shigorin">mike</who>
    <bug_when>2017-05-16 14:42:32 +0300</bug_when>
    <thetext>(В ответ на комментарий №5)
&gt; мне отчего-то кажется, что дело в том, что кто-то не установил нужный mkfs.*
Набор таковых в регулярках уже довольно давно не изменялся, если что.</thetext>
  </long_desc>
      
      

    </bug>

</bugzilla>